Warren Hills Regional was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ss. They took a 35-25 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Bridgewater-Raritan Panthers. The Blue Streaks were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Panthers ap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in December of 2023.
Warren Hills Regional's loss dropped their record down to 1-8. As for Bridgewater-Raritan,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 3-6.
Warren Hills Regional will welcome Hunterdon Central at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Bridgewater-Raritan has already played their next game (against Kent Place),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
